如何查服务器端口号

worktile 其他 44

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要查找服务器端口号的方法有多种,以下是几种常用的方法:

    1. 使用命令行工具:在Windows系统中,打开命令提示符(CMD)或Powershell,输入命令"netstat -ano",然后按回车键。这会显示所有正在运行的进程和它们使用的端口号。在Linux系统中,使用命令"sudo netstat -tuln"来查看正在运行的服务以及它们所侦听的端口号。

    2. 使用网络工具:有许多网络工具可用于查找服务器端口号。其中一个常用的工具是Nmap。在使用Nmap之前,需要先在计算机上安装这个工具。然后,在命令行中输入命令"nmap -p <起始端口号>-<终止端口号> <服务器IP地址>",将起始端口号和终止端口号替换为您想要扫描的端口范围,以及服务器IP地址替换为您要扫描的服务器的IP地址。

    3. 使用端口扫描工具:如果您不想使用命令行工具,也可以考虑使用一些图形界面的端口扫描工具。一些常见的工具包括Angry IP Scanner、Advanced Port Scanner、Zenmap等。这些工具提供了直观的界面,使您可以轻松地扫描并查找服务器上的端口号。

    4. 查询文档或配置文件:如果您可以访问服务器上的操作系统或应用程序的文档或配置文件,您也可以查找到服务器使用的端口号。例如,许多Web服务器使用HTTP的默认端口号80,HTTPS使用默认端口号443。要确定服务器使用的端口号,您可以查看Web服务器的配置文件,如Apache的httpd.conf文件或Nginx的nginx.conf文件等。

    无论您选择哪种方法,都应该牢记服务器端口号的重要性,以确保网络安全。如果您无法确定某个特定端口号的用途,请参考相关文档或与服务器管理员联系以获取更多信息。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要查找服务器的端口号,您可以按照以下几个步骤进行操作:

    1. 使用命令行工具:

      • 在Windows上,打开命令提示符或PowerShell。
      • 在Mac或Linux上,打开终端。
    2. 输入以下命令来查找已知的端口号:

      • Windows上的命令:netstat -ano
      • Mac和Linux上的命令:netstat -tln

      这些命令将显示所有正在监听的端口和与之关联的进程的信息。

    3. 查找特定的端口号:如果您只想查找特定的端口号,您可以使用以下命令:

      • Windows上的命令:netstat -ano | findstr "端口号"
      • Mac和Linux上的命令:sudo lsof -i :端口号

      替换"端口号"为您要查找的实际端口号。

    4. 使用网络工具:您还可以使用各种网络工具来查找服务器的端口号。其中一些常用的工具包括:

      • Wireshark:一个开源的网络分析工具,可以用来捕获和分析网络数据包,其中包括服务器的端口号信息。
      • Nmap:一个网络探测和安全审核工具,可以扫描服务器上的端口并提供详细的端口号列表。
    5. 查看服务器配置文件:如果服务器运行的是特定的应用程序或服务,您还可以查看服务器配置文件来获取端口号的信息。配置文件通常位于服务器的安装目录中或操作系统的特定目录中。您可以查找文件中包含端口号的配置项。

    请注意,查找服务器端口号的能力可能受到您对服务器的访问权限的限制。您可能需要以管理员身份运行命令或具有足够的权限来访问配置文件。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要查找服务器的端口号,可以使用以下几种方法:

    方法一:使用命令行工具

    1. 打开终端或命令提示符(Windows系统可以按下Win+R键,在弹出的运行窗口中输入cmd并按下回车键)。
    2. 输入以下命令:(以Windows系统为例)
    netstat -ano | findstr "LISTENING"
    

    或者在Linux或Mac系统中,输入以下命令:

    netstat -tlnp
    

    其中,-t参数表示TCP连接,-l参数表示只显示监听状态的端口,-n参数表示直接显示端口号,-p参数表示显示进程ID。

    1. 按下回车键后,系统会列出所有正在监听的端口和对应的进程ID。

    方法二:使用端口扫描工具

    1. 下载并安装一个端口扫描工具,例如Nmap。
    2. 打开Nmap,并输入服务器的IP地址或域名。
    3. 设置扫描范围或使用默认设置,然后点击扫描按钮。
    4. Nmap会扫描服务器上的所有端口,并在扫描结果中显示端口号和对应的服务。

    方法三:使用网络工具

    1. 在浏览器中打开一个网络工具网站,例如https://www.yougetsignal.com/tools/open-ports/。
    2. 在工具网站的输入框中输入服务器的IP地址或域名。
    3. 点击“Check”按钮,工具会扫描服务器上的所有开放的端口,并显示在结果页面中。

    方法四:查看服务器配置文件

    1. 登录服务器,并找到服务器应用程序的配置文件,例如Apache的配置文件通常位于/etc/httpd/目录下,Nginx的配置文件通常位于/etc/nginx/目录下。
    2. 打开配置文件,查找监听端口的设置项,并记录下端口号。

    方法五:咨询管理员或服务提供商
    如果你有服务器管理员或服务提供商,可以直接向他们咨询服务器的端口号。

    总结:通过命令行工具、端口扫描工具、网络工具、查看配置文件或咨询管理员等方式,都可以找到服务器的端口号。选择合适的方法根据个人需求和能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部